Related occupations
Explore related occupations in the claims specialist sector.
Assistant Underwriter
An Assistant Underwriter supports the assessment of loan, credit, or insurance applications by gathering financial information and managing administrative tasks.
Claims Officer
A Claims Officer processes insurance claims by collecting details, liaising with clients, and providing support throughout the claims process.
Assistant Broker
An Assistant Broker supports finance professionals by helping clients with loans and insurance, managing paperwork, and facilitating communication.
Insurance Consultant
An Insurance Consultant helps clients manage insurance policies, process applications and claims, and find suitable coverage options.
Insurance Broker
An Insurance Broker arranges insurance policies for clients, advising them on options and acting as a liaison with financial institutions.
Insurance Claims Assessor
An Insurance Claims Assessor evaluates and investigates claims, advises clients on outcomes, completes paperwork, and ensures accuracy and compliance.
Claims Consultant
A Claims Consultant evaluates insurance claims, determines validity, processes applications, and communicates with policyholders, focusing on service.
Risk Analyst
A Risk Analyst evaluates data to assess risk for clients and businesses, guiding decisions and policies while communicating findings clearly.
Insurance Analyst
An Insurance Analyst analyses insurance data to inform pricing strategies and risk assessments, preparing reports and collaborating on new products.
Actuarial Consultant
An Actuarial Consultant advises on financial risk using mathematical models to help organisations make informed decisions about insurance and pensions.
Actuarial Analyst
An Actuarial Analyst evaluates financial risks using mathematics and statistics to inform risk management and investment decisions.
Insurance Specialist
An Insurance Specialist manages and advises on insurance policies, analysing risks and ensuring clients have appropriate coverage and support.
Risk Advisor
A Risk Advisor guides organisations in identifying and mitigating risks, developing strategies, conducting assessments, and ensuring compliance.
Risk Consultant
A Risk Consultant helps organisations identify and mitigate potential risks by conducting assessments, developing management strategies, and ensuring compliance.
Insurance Underwriter
An Insurance Underwriter evaluates insurance applications, analyses risks, and determines premiums, ensuring policies comply with company and legal guidelines.
